Buying Guide

Size and Capacity

When choosing the best small countertop microwave, capacity matters as much as external dimensions. A 0.7 cu. ft. microwave is usually best for very tight spaces, while 0.9 cu. ft. models provide a little more flexibility. If you want more room without stepping into a full-size appliance, 1.2 cu. ft. options can be a practical middle ground.

Wattage

Wattage affects how quickly and evenly a microwave heats food. In this roundup, 700W models are best for basic reheating and light cooking, while 900W and 1000W models generally offer stronger performance. If speed matters and you use your microwave often, higher wattage is usually worth considering.

Convenience Features

Features like auto menus, express cook, mute functions, ECO Mode, and sound on/off can make a big difference in everyday use. These extras help simplify cooking and make the appliance more comfortable in small homes, dorms, and shared spaces. Safety and Family Use

If children will be around the appliance, look for a child safety lock. This feature adds peace of mind in family kitchens and shared living situations. It’s one of the most practical additions you can get in a compact microwave.

Frequently Asked Questions

What size is best for a small countertop microwave?

For most people, 0.7 cu. ft. is the smallest practical size, especially for dorms, offices, or very compact kitchens. If you want a bit more flexibility, 0.9 cu. ft. can be a better balance of size and usability.

Is 700 watts enough for a small microwave?

Yes, 700 watts is enough for basic reheating, defrosting, and light cooking. If you want faster heating or more versatility, 900W or 1000W models are usually better suited.

Do I need a mute function on a microwave?

A mute function is not essential, but it can be very helpful in apartments, dorm rooms, and shared homes. If you prefer a quieter kitchen experience, it’s a feature worth having.

Are child safety locks useful on countertop microwaves?

Yes, especially for families with young children. A child safety lock can prevent accidental use and offer extra peace of mind.

Which is better: 0.7 cu. ft. or 0.9 cu. ft.?

0.7 cu. ft. is better for tighter spaces and simple use, while 0.9 cu. ft. gives you a little more cooking room. If your counter can handle it, 0.9 cu. ft. is often the more versatile option.
